「半導体ウェーハ研磨パッドの世界市場」は、地域的には米州、アジア、欧州、中東・アフリカ市場をカバーしており、種類別には、ハードCMPパッド、ソフトCMPパッドなど、用途別には、300mmウェーハ、200mmウェーハ、その他などに区分してまとめた調査レポートです。半導体ウェーハ研磨パッドのグローバル市場規模、主要地域・主要国別、種類別、用途別の市場予測、主要企業の概要・市場シェア・販売量、市場動向などの情報が含まれています。
